What are some common challenges faced by pest control technicians working in a college campus environment?

Pest control technicians on college campuses often face unique challenges, such as managing pest issues in large, diverse buildings with high foot traffic and varying sanitation practices. They must coordinate with facilities staff, dormitory managers, and sometimes even students to identify problem areas while minimizing disruption to campus activities. Additionally, ensuring the safety of students and staff means adhering strictly to regulations regarding pesticide use and always opting for integrated pest management techniques whenever possible. This role requires strong communication skills and flexibility, as technicians may respond to urgent calls or work during off-hours to treat sensitive areas.

What is a Pest Control College?

A Pest Control College is an educational institution or program that provides training and certification for individuals who want to work in the pest management industry. These colleges offer courses on pest identification, safe pesticide use, integrated pest management, and legal regulations. Graduates are equipped with the knowledge and skills necessary to control pests safely and effectively in residential, commercial, and agricultural settings. Some programs also help students prepare for state licensing exams required for professional pest control technicians.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Pest Control Technician,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Pest Control Technician, you need a solid understanding of pest biology, safety protocols, and basic math, typically supported by a high school diploma and state certification or licensure. Familiarity with application equipment, chemical handling systems, and digital reporting tools is often required. Attention to detail, strong problem-solving abilities, and effective customer communication help technicians stand out. These skills are crucial for ensuring safe, compliant, and effective pest management solutions for clients.
